**Action item (from the Driftline postmortem):** So, the tide-table widget on Harborview was showing yesterday's low tide because we cached the lookup keyed on weekday instead of date. Classic. Fix itself is small — swap the cache key and add a regression test with a mocked clock crossing midnight — but please review the cache invalidation path carefully, since Priya suspects there's a second stale read in the coastal summary panel. Full timeline and the cache diagram are on the incident page.

runbook for taduf-kawef: https://confluence.qorvelsys.internal/projects/display/display/pages

**Release checklist — Lintrel Metrics 4.2**

Verify monthly partitions exist for orders_events through next quarter. The partition bot on Quillhaven staging sometimes skips the rollover if the release lands near month-end; create missing partitions manually before cutover. Confirm the default partition is empty — rows landing there mean the bot failed silently. Do not drop old partitions during release week. Record the build token below for audit.

build token for fajof-yahof: htk4_869f

# Env config for Coalesce, the on-call alert deduplicator.
# Plugin authors: Coalesce loads this file at startup and passes
# DEDUPE_* vars to your plugin's init hook. Set DEDUPE_WINDOW and
# DEDUPE_STRATEGY here; anything else is plugin-specific. Plugins
# that call back into the Coalesce core API must authenticate,
# and the core expects that credential defined on the next line:

secret setting of yajog-taguf: ARCHIVE_KEY3=051